Output 99b35ae2366a7242c984176ea31d3a9ed559da803a43397496e9c168595154e7:0

value
526770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b49b36dcb5e91ad3ab1174d40f91ac5084676d3 OP_EQUAL
address
3QbhpXBBPTc3e8vgwnYTbz4Mk8wkr9dLck
transaction
99b35ae2366a7242c984176ea31d3a9ed559da803a43397496e9c168595154e7
spent
true